My Checker Box Hong Kong

An updated, more stylish version of the “compartment store” has recently arrived. My Checker Box, located just a block away from Elizabeth House in Causeway Bay, provides a shopping thrill similar to browsing capsule toys. (For those of you unfamiliar with them, capsule toys are sold in clear plastic bubbles from vending machines.)

My Checker Box’s ground floor location, rare for this sort of shop, is a large 1900 square feet. Instead of a single owner, compartment shops typically rent out small cases of varying sizes to potentially over 100 different want-to-be retailers. The interior of the store includes modifiable compartments so that renters can create a tailored fit for their inventory. It’s up to the individual tenant what kind of merchandise they’d like to sell in their box.

The space is well lit, and features an interesting design both inside and outside the shop. Part of what makes the place attractive is that the items for sale (in clear plastic cases,) become part of the design. (more…)

Rafik Pimpin Aint Easy Hong Kong

Pimpin’ Ain’t Easy, a monthly night that champions new styles of dance music is celebrating their first anniversary on Friday, August 7th. Over the course of one year, the somewhat under-appreciated party has brought over a dozen up and coming international d.j.s to Hong Kong.

P.A.E. has also filled a niche in the city’s nightlife landscape. Where other clubs such as Dragon-i and Volar bring major names, P.A.E. showcases rising talents who are just beginning to make waves on the global scene. (more…)
